MODEBUS 地址说明
在帮助目录的库栏目。
通常以 5 个字符值的形式写入Modbus 地址,其中包含数据类型和偏移量。第一个字符决定数据类型,后四个字符包含值。
Modbus 主站寻址
Modbus 主站指令将地址映射至正确功能,以发送到从站设备。Modbus 主站指令支持下列Modbus 地址:
00001 至09999 是离散量输出(线圈)
10001 至19999 是离散量输入(触点)
30001 至39999 是输入寄存器(通常是模拟量输入)
(40001 至49999)和(400001 至465535)是保持寄存器
所有Modbus 地址均从 1 开始,也就是说第一个数据值从地址1 开始。实际有效地址范围取决于从站设备。不同的从站设备支持不同的数据类型和地址范围。
Modbus 从站寻址
Modbus 主站设备将地址映射至正确的功能。Modbus 从站指令支持下列地址:
00001 至00256 是映射到- 的离散量输出
10001 至10256 是映射到- 的离散量输入
30001 至30056 是映射到AIW0 - AIW110 的模拟量输入寄存器
40001 至49999 和400001 至465535 是映射到V 存储器的保持寄存器。将Modbus 地址映射到CPU 地址
所有Modbus 地址均从 1 开始。
将Modbus 地址映射到CPU 地址
所有Modbus 地址均从 1 开始。
将Modbus 地址映射到CPU 地址
Modbus 地址CPU 地址
00001
00002
00003
......
00255
00256
10001
10002
10003
10255
10256I317
30001AIW0
30002AIW2
30003AIW4
30056AIW110
40001 400001Vx(保持寄存器起始地址)40002400002Vx+2 =(保持寄存器起始地址+2)40003400003Vx+4 =(保持寄存器起始地址+4)
......
4yyyy4zzzzz Vx+2(yyyy-1) 或Vx+2(zzzzz-1)
Modbus 从站协议允许您限制Modbus 主站可访问的输入、输出、模拟量输入和保持寄存器(V 存储器)的数目。
MaxIQ指定允许Modbus 主站访问的离散量输入或输出(I 或Q)的最大数目。
MaxAI指定允许Modbus 主站访问的输入寄存器(AIW) 的最大数目。
MaxHold指定允许Modbus 主站访问的保持寄存器(V 存储器字)的最大数目。